Dear brothers! Zakat is the basic pillar of Islam and became Fard in 2 Hijri before the Siyam. 1/40th part of the Nisab (i.e. 2.5%) will have to be given as Zakat. It is proven from the Holy Quran that Zakat is Fard; one who denies it is a Kafir. The Beloved Rasoolصَ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 has stated, ‘The foundation of Islam is on five acts: To testify that there is none worthy of worship except Allah عَزَّ وَجَلَّ and Muhammad ص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 is His Rasool; to offer Salah; to pay Zakat; to perform Hajj; and to observe Sawm of Ramadan.’

(Bukhari/Kitab ul Iman)

The significance of Zakat can be observed by the fact that: Salah and Zakat have been mentioned together in the Holy Quran 32 times.

(Radd ul Mukhtar/Kitabuzakat)

Besides this, the fortunate Zakat-giving person receives great blessings and benefits of this world and the Hereafter.


Zakat is Fard

It is proven from the Holy Quran and Sunnah that Zakat is Fard. Allah عَزَّ وَجَلَّ has stated in the Holy Quran:

وَ اَقِیْمُوا الصَّلٰوةَ وَ اٰتُوا الزَّكٰوةَ

Translation from Kanz-ul-Imaan: And establish (obligatory) prayer, and give Zakat.

(Part 1, Surah Al-Baqarah, verse 43)

Maulana Sayyid Muhammad Na’eemuddin Muradabadi رَحْمَۃُ اللہِ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 (who passed away in 1367 Hijri) has stated: This Ayah says about Salah and Zakat being Fard.

When the Beloved Rasool ص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 sent Sayyiduna Mu’aaz رَضِیَ ا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َنْہُ towards Yemen, he ص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 said: Tell them that Allah عَزَّ وَجَلَّ has made Zakat Fard in their wealth; it should be taken from the wealthy people and given to the Fuqara [poor people.

(Tirmizi/Kitabuzakat)

Definition of Zakat

That wealth specified by Shari’ah is termed as Zakat from which a person discontinues his benefit in every manner and then for the pleasure of Allah عَزَّ وَجَلَّ, it is given into the possession of such Muslim Faqeer [Shari’ah-declared poor person], who is neither Hashmi himself nor is he a slave freed by any Hashmi.

(Durr e Mukhtar/Kitabuzakat)

On whom is Zakat Fard?

Giving Zakat is Fard on every such ‘Aaqil [sane] and Baligh [person who has reached puberty] Muslim who is not a slave and who meets the following conditions:

1 He owns Nisab.

2 This Nisab is Naami [growing in nature].

3 He has Nisab in his possession.

4 Nisab is exclusive of his Haajat-e-Asliyyah (i.e. basic necessities of life).

5 Nisab is exclusive of the money he owes (i.e. he should not owe the people such debt that his Nisab will no longer remain if he pays it).

6 A year passes on this Nisab.

(Bahar e Shariat)

Punishments of not giving Zakat

Not giving Zakat is a cause of destruction of wealth as the Beloved Rasool ص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 has said: The wealth that has got destroyed in the land and sea, it has got destroyed because of not giving Zakat.

(Majma-ul-Zwaed/KitabulZakat)

At another place, he ص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 has said: Wealth of Zakat will destroy the [wealth] in which it will be present.

(Shob-ul-Iman)

Explaining the abovementioned Hadith, Mufti Muhammad Amjad Ali A’zami رَحْمَۃُ اللہِ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 has stated, ‘Some great Ulama have stated the following meaning of this Hadith: If Zakat becomes Wajib on a person but he does not pay it and keeps it included in his wealth, this Haraam will destroy that Halal. Imam Ahmad رَحْمَۃُ اللہِ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 has stated the following meaning: If a wealthy person takes Wealth of Zakat, this Wealth of Zakat will destroy his wealth as Zakat is for the Fuqara [poor people]. Both the meanings are correct.’

(Bahar-e-Shariat)

The nation which does not give Zakat can suffer from troubles collectively. The Beloved Rasool ص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 has said: The nation which will not give Zakat, Allah عَزَّ وَجَلَّ will make it suffer from drought.

(Al Moj-ul-Osat)

At another place, he ص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 has said: When the people abandon paying Zakat, Allah عَزَّ وَجَلَّ stops the rain. If quadrupeds were not present on the Earth, even a single drop of water would not fall from the sky.

(Ibn-e-Majah)

The person who does not give Zakat has been cursed, as Sayyiduna Abdullah bin Mas’ood رَضِیَ ا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َنْہُ has narrated: Rasoolullah صَلَّی اللہُ تَعَالٰی عَلَیْہِ وَاٰلِہٖ وَسَلَّمَ has cursed the one who does not give Zakat.

(Sahih Ibn-e-Khuzaimah)
